On Tue, Apr 18, 2017 at 04:20:10PM -0500, Tom Lendacky wrote:
> Since DMA addresses will effectively look like 48-bit addresses when the
> memory encryption mask is set, SWIOTLB is needed if the DMA mask of the
> device performing the DMA does not support 48-bits. SWIOTLB will be
> initialized to create decrypted bounce buffers for use by these devices.

Use a verb in the subject:

Subject: x86, swiotlb: Add memory encryption support

or similar.
